Generator of infrasonic fluctuations

The purpose of the developed device is intensifying the emotional perception of an acoustic signal by additional tactile and visual sensations. Close to a powerful low-frequency dynamic speaker, a human body feels vibrations of air and this effect considerably intensifies perception of music. The below-described device generates air vibrations synchronized with the acoustic signal in the infrasonic range. The amplitude of such vibrations is larger as compared to the amplitude of the ones generated by a low-frequency dynamic speaker, so they cause a sensation that the acoustic system is more powerful that it is in realty. A tactile sensation of the air flow is possible in a close distance from the device. However, in case of operation of a smoke generator or waving of flags, the air vibrations will be remarkable in a larger distance. The device consists of a fan with a variable-pitch prop fixed on it. Variation of the pitch is bound with the amplitude of the acoustic signal in a certain frequency range. Usually, the bass range frequency is singled out; however, vocal range frequencies or high frequencies may be singled out, if they express better the acoustic accents in music. For generating powerful infrasonic vibrations, the fan should rotate in a special hole in the wall between two sections; however, it is not required for decorative effect, so in such a case, the fan may be installed in an open place.
